Please note, institutional investors have a lot of resources and new technology at their disposal. They can put in a lot of research and financial analysis when reviewing investment options. There are many different types of institutional investors, including banks, hedge funds, insurance companies, and pension plans. One of the main advantages they have over retail investors is the fees paid for trades. As they are buying in large quantities, they can manage their cost more effectively.

Braemar Preferred Stock Ownership Analysis
About 18.0% of the company shares are held by institutions such as insurance companies. The company recorded a loss per share of 0.3. Braemar Hotels Resorts last dividend was issued on the 30th of March 2023. Braemar Hotels Resorts is a real estate investment trust focused on investing in luxury hotels and resorts. Braemar Hotels operates under REITHotel Motel classification in the United States and is traded on NYQ Exchange.
